How are machine learning and artificial intelligence applied in human-computer interaction?

Machine learning and artificial intelligence (AI) are increasingly applied in human-computer interaction (HCI) to enhance the way users interact with technology by making systems more intuitive, responsive, and personalized. Here's how they are applied and an example:

Application in HCI:

  1. Natural Language Processing (NLP): AI algorithms analyze and understand human language, enabling voice-activated commands and more natural conversations with devices.

  2. Predictive Analytics: Machine learning models can predict user behavior based on past interactions, allowing systems to proactively offer assistance or suggestions.

  3. Personalization: AI tailors the user experience based on individual preferences and habits, improving engagement and satisfaction.

  4. Gesture Recognition: Machine learning enables systems to interpret and respond to human gestures, creating a more immersive interaction.

Example:

Imagine a smart home system that uses machine learning to understand your daily routine. As you approach your home, the system recognizes you through facial recognition and greets you by name. It then adjusts the lighting, temperature, and music to your preferences without any explicit commands. This is all made possible by AI algorithms that learn from your past behaviors and preferences.
